var t = true;
var f = false;
var a = t && null;
var b = f && null;
var c = null && t;
var d = null && f;
alert("true null: " + a);
alert("false null: " + b);
alert("null true: " + c);
alert("null false: " + d);
var n = null;
var xx = "xxx";
alert("! true: " + !t);
alert("! false: " + !f);
alert("! null: " + !n);
alert("! xx: " + !xx);
结果:
null
false
null
null
false
true
true
false
分享到:
相关推荐
### 常用JavaScript语句详解 #### 1. `document.write("")` 输出语句 在JavaScript中,`document.write()` 方法用于将指定的内容写入正在加载的文档中。这通常用于动态创建网页内容。 #### 2. JS中的注释为`//` 在...
在JavaScript编程语言中,`var`关键字是一种至关重要的声明变量的机制。理解其工作原理对于编写可维护和无错误的代码至关重要。以下是对`var`关键字的深入解析: ### 1. 声明变量 `var`的主要作用是声明一个变量。...
JavaScript是一种广泛应用于网页和网络应用的编程语言,它在网页中负责实现动态效果、交互功能以及数据处理。本文将深入探讨一些JavaScript的基础知识、技巧和方法。 首先,创建JavaScript脚本块是通过`<script>`...
### JavaScript语法手册知识点详解 #### 一、JavaScript函数 JavaScript是一种广泛使用的编程语言,尤其适用于Web开发。在JavaScript中,函数是一段可重用的代码块,用于执行特定任务。 ##### 1. GetObject函数 -...
**JavaScript**是一种轻量级的编程语言,被广泛应用于网页开发中,用于增强网页的交互性与动态效果。以下是一些基本的语法和使用技巧。 ##### 1. 嵌入JavaScript代码 在HTML文档中嵌入JavaScript代码可以通过`...
JavaScript 中的 var、let、const 的区别 JavaScript 中的变量声明方式有多种,包括 var、let 和 const。这三种方式都可以用来声明变量,但它们之间有一些关键的区别。 var 声明 在 JavaScript 中,使用 var ...
### JavaScript字符串函数大全 在JavaScript中,字符串是用于处理文本数据的基本类型之一。字符串方法提供了丰富的功能来操作这些文本数据,使得开发人员能够更高效地完成各种任务。下面将详细介绍标题与描述中提及...
根据给定文件的信息,我们可以总结出以下关于JavaScript的相关知识点: ### 一、基本概念与语法 **1. 输出文本** JavaScript 提供了多种输出文本的方法,例如 `document.write`。在给定的内容中,可以看到一个...
在JavaScript编程中,掌握常用的方法和技巧是至关重要的。以下是一些核心知识点的详细说明: 1. **创建脚本块**:在HTML中,我们通常使用`<script>`标签来插入JavaScript代码。例如: ```html <script language="...
- **非强制初始化**:与Java等静态类型语言不同,JavaScript中的变量可以在声明时不进行初始化。 ```javascript var test; // 声明但未初始化 ``` - **变量提升**:即使变量在使用前没有显式声明,JavaScript也...
在 JavaScript 中,我们使用 `var` 关键字来声明变量。例如: ```javascript var myVariable; ``` 变量的命名应遵循一定的规则,通常使用驼峰式命名(camelCase)。 字符串连接: 在 JavaScript 中,使用 `+` ...
AJAX(Asynchronous JavaScript and XML)允许浏览器在不刷新整个页面的情况下与服务器交换数据。这可以创建更加流畅的用户体验,例如实时加载更多内容: ```javascript var xhr = new XMLHttpRequest(); xhr....
通过以上知识点的学习,我们可以看到JavaScript是一种非常强大的语言,它不仅可以用来处理基本的数据类型和逻辑控制,还能与浏览器进行深度交互,从而实现动态、交互丰富的网页应用。开发者可以根据实际需求灵活运用...
对非JavaScript浏览器的支持 当浏览器不支持JavaScript时,可以通过`<noscript>`标签提供备选内容。例如: ```html Hello to the non-JavaScript browser. ``` 这段代码将在不支持JavaScript的浏览器中显示...
处理非JavaScript浏览器 为了确保兼容性,可以使用`<noscript>`标签为不支持JavaScript的浏览器提供替代内容。例如: ```html Hello to the non-JavaScript browser. ``` ### 4. 引入外部脚本文件 可以使用`...
15、分析javascript代码段,输出结果是: B var a="125.8765"; c=parseInt(a); d=parseFloat(a); document.write(c+" "+d) A) 125.8765 126 B) 125 125.8765 C) 125.8765 125 D) 126 125.8765
在深入解析`var`与非`var`全局变量的区别之前,我们先来了解一下它们的共同点。 全局变量都是在全局作用域中定义的,这意味着它们在整个脚本或网页中都可访问。如果在函数内部定义了一个全局变量,那么即使函数执行...
在JavaScript中,`var`关键字用于声明变量,它告诉解释器创建一个新变量。需要注意的是,JavaScript中的变量名是区分大小写的,例如`A`和`a`是不同的变量。 变量声明和赋值可以分开执行,例如: ```javascript var...